Kwang‐Soon Ahn is a scholar working on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Materials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Kwang‐Soon Ahn has authored 231 papers receiving a total of 5.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 140 papers in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ment, 124 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ering and 115 papers in Materials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Kwang‐Soon Ahn's work include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(109 papers), TiO2 Photocatalysis and Solar Cells (81 papers) and Transition Metal Oxide Nanomaterials (45 papers). Kwang‐Soon Ahn is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(109 papers), TiO2 Photocatalysis and Solar Cells (81 papers) and Transition Metal Oxide Nanomaterials (45 papers). Kwang‐Soon Ahn collaborates with scholars based in South Korea, United States and Germany. Kwang‐Soon Ahn's co-authors include Soon Hyung Kang, Yung‐Eun Sung, Jae‐Hong Kim, Hyunsoo Kim, Yanfa Yan, John Anthuvan Rajesh, Mowafak Al‐Jassim, Yoon‐Chae Nah, John A. Turner and Moon‐Sung Kang and has published in prestigious journals such as Energy & Environmental Science, Applied Physics Letters and Journal of Applied Physics.
